I work at Norton Healthcare in Louisville, KY. We are having issues with employees using the drop down banking information. Some of the information (routing numbers) it stores is incorrect, therefore it is becoming an issue because many employees are not getting their direct deposits....

Does anyone know how we can remove/disable the drop down in ESS so the employees have to manually key everything from their checks into the system?

We modified the directdepositlib.js file in "xhrnet\directdeposit\jslib" to make the field read only. The employee has to select from the dropdown. If their bank isn't listed they are instructed to contact our HRIS department. HRIS will enter the bank on PR12.4.

We originally allowed EEs to manually enter their data but had too much bad data being entered. Using the FedWire data cleaned up all our bank data and added banks that weren't present in our list. Now the only banks we need to enter are banks not in FedWire, which isn't very many, mostly outside the US.

We have a recurring job to download the FED file from this site, parse it and update PR12.4. The file is a string of bytes and the layout is also available on the site.

We have also modified ESS to change the order of fields entered. The employees enter the routing number first (no drop downs) and this is validated using PR12.4 and bank name is displayed.

I have created a process that maintains the list of ACH Banks using the Fed Site. The flow does the following:

* downloads the file (System Command to run VBS script),
* parses each line of the downloaded file,
* compares the bank ID against your records on PR12.4,
* adds the bank when the bank is missing from your system, and
* renames the bank when your system has the routing number with a different name

I would think that this would handle most of the issues listed in this thread.

Look in lrs/webdocs/lawson/xhrnet/directeposit/jslib/directdepositlib.js. We commented out the drop-down years ago for the same reason...no good way to verifiy routing number and such. we only display their current DD info. we added a message & link that says "Contact Corp PR to establish DD account", the link takes them to our PR group. We also run ESS for ~30,000 employees (out of 250,000), so it's do-able for large number.

I am not sure but does the configuration setting mentioned in teh installation guide get you to where you want to be.

This setting controls whether the employee is
allowed to manually enter a new bank name and
manual_bank_entry
routing number when adding a direct deposit
account in the Direct Deposit task. The default
value of this setting is "true". When set to "false",
the system will require the employee to select
from a list of predefined banks set up on PR12.
4. For Canadian Direct Deposit, this setting
controls manual entry of the institution, institution
number, and transit number. For U.K. Direct
Deposit, this setting controls manual entry of the
bank/building society and sort code.
